      Responsibilities:

      · Android development: Working on real-time projects and participate in the complete lifecycle of a project delivery.

      · AI/ML Development: Assist in researching, creating, and deploying AI/ML models using Generative AI.

      · Android Integration: Help integrate AI and ML models into Android and web applications to improve functionality.

      · Utilize AI Tools: Work with tools such as GCP Dialogflow and Vertex AI to drive project outcomes and innovation.

      · Collaborate: Work with software engineering directors, architects, and senior engineers to achieve project goals.

      · Documentation: Maintain clear documentation of your work, present findings, and demos to the team.


      Qualifications:
      • · Educational Background: Pursuing a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Data Science, or a related field.

        · AI/ML Knowledge: Good understanding of AI/ML concepts and experience with GCP or Azure AI services.

        · Programming Skills: Proficiency in Java and Kotlin, NodeJS, Python.

        · Android Development: Good knowledge of Android development.

        · AI Tools Knowledge: Familiarity with OpenAI’s GPT models and ChatGPT is a plus.

        Preferred Skills:

      • · Hands-on Projects: Experience with AI/ML projects or Android development is advantageous.

        · Hands-on Tools: Experience with Android Studio, Google Vertex AI, Dialogflow, OpenAI’s GPT models, ChatGPT, and Azure AI.

        · Version Control: Knowledge of Git and other development tools.

      Zebra Technologies Corporation is an American public company based in Lincolnshire, Illinois, USA, that manufactures and sells marking, tracking and computer printing technologies.
